The Kiss and Makeup Beauty Awards 2008: Best Treatment

3 week manicure.jpg

Winner: Nails Inc 3 Week Manicure

This is great because.. well the clue is in the title! It does actually last three weeks thanks to them using acrylic gel, and it means your nails are rock hard, so they don't break. You get three weeks of groomed talons followed with naturally long nails, so you're an all round winner.

Buy it if you bite your nails regularly, chip your varnish within 2 seconds and want a more polished hassle free look.

Get it from £50 at Nails Inc Counters

The Kiss and Makeup Beauty Awards 2008: Best Beauty Salon

cucumba award.jpg
Winner: Cucumba the Urban Pit Stop

This is great because you can just pop in straight off the street without needing a booking. They cater to the time weary by sectioning their treatment packages into slots of 15 minutes and are priced extremely competitively, as well as being just off Oxford street.

Go if you need a breather after a days shopping or only have half an hour before/after work.
